WebThis instability of the symmetry-breaking scale is known as the gauge hierarchy problem. Two theoretical approaches have been taken in constructing a theory of electroweak symmetry breaking that does not suffer from the hierarchy problem: supersymmetry and strongly interacting symmetry breaking.
